Robot Outruns Humans In Beijing Half Marathon

An autonomous robot made history on April 19, 2026, when it beat 12,000 human runners and 300 fellow robots in a half marathon at China’s Beijing E-Town. The aptly-named Lightning pulled away early and never slowed down. It finished the 13.1-mile (21.1 km) race in just 50 minutes and 26 seconds. The top human finisher, Zhao Haijie, crossed the line about 10 minutes later.

“It just went whoosh right past me,” Zhao later said.

In addition to winning the race, Lightning also beat the human half marathon world record by nearly seven minutes. Jacob Kiplimo set that record in a race in Lisbon, Portugal, in March 2026.

However, not all of the robots ran as smoothly. Some started strong but quickly wobbled or even fell within the first few steps. Others made it further but struggled over the long distance. They veered off course or needed assistance to stay upright. A few crossed the finish line only to stumble into barriers moments later.

Despite these mishaps, the robots performed far better than those in Beijing E-Town’s first race, held in 2025. Many of those early machines struggled with overheating, balance issues, or breakdowns during the 13.1-mile course. Only six of the 21 participating robots managed to finish. In contrast, more than 100 robots completed the race this year. Also, in 2025, the first robot took over 2 hours and 40 minutes to cross the finish line. The progress shows just how much technology has improved in a single year.

The half marathon is part of a wider effort at Beijing E-Town, formally known as the Beijing Economic-Technological Development Area. Established in 1994, it is a testing ground for robotics, artificial intelligence, and advanced manufacturing. The half marathon reflects its goal of testing new technology in real-world conditions.
